About the Book

Temples of Transcendence: ISKCON's Global Mission and the Path to BhaktiFrom a small storefront in New York City to grand temples across continents, the International Society for Krishna Consciousness (ISKCON) has transformed the spiritual landscape of the modern world. Temples of Transcendence delves into the profound impact of these sacred spaces-how they serve as spiritual sanctuaries, centers of learning, and hubs of selfless service-guiding millions toward Krishna consciousness. This book traces the vision of Srila Prabhupada, the founder of ISKCON, who brought the ancient wisdom of Bhakti to the West and established a global movement. Through captivating narratives, it explores the architectural grandeur of ISKCON temples, blending traditional Vedic styles with modern innovation. It uncovers the daily rituals, kirtans, and Bhagavatam discourses that create an atmosphere of transcendence, offering devotees a direct connection to the divine. Beyond worship, ISKCON temples play a vital role in social outreach-feeding millions through Food for Life, providing education, and fostering interfaith harmony. This book shares personal stories of transformation, from wandering seekers to devoted monks, illustrating how these temples change lives. As ISKCON embraces the digital age with virtual darshans, online kirtans, and global satsangs, Temples of Transcendence contemplates the future of devotion in an evolving world. Whether you are a long-time devotee or a curious seeker, this book invites you to step inside these sacred spaces, immerse yourself in Bhakti, and embark on a journey that transcends time, culture, and geography-toward Krishna's divine embrace.
